How much did Scott County, Missouri receive in farm subsidies in FY2025?

In fiscal year 2025 (October 2024–September 2025), Scott County, Missouri received $14.8M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 1,034 records. That is $391.22 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ates.

What was the top USDA program in Scott County, Missouri in FY2025?

The largest USDA program in Scott County, Missouri in FY2025 was EMERGENCY COMMODITY ASSISTANCE PROGRAM, which paid $13,137K.
